President Cyril Ramaphosa Is In Uganda For A Working Visit.

His Excellency The President of South Africa, Cyril Ramaphosa who jetted in last night is in Uganda for a working visit where and today the 16th of April he has met with H.E Yoweri Kaguta Museveni at state house Entebbe.

He was welcomed by the Minister of Foreign Affairs in-charge of regional affairs Hon. John Mulumba at the Entebbe International Airport.

Their discussion with President Museveni were around regional security and stability, trade, diplomacy and bilateral relations and the situation in the the Eastern Democratic Republic of Congo.
